The Bedfordshire Regiment in the Great War
1916 War Diary
[Note that all remarks in squared brackets are my own additions and not part of the original text]
War Diary for January 1916

1 Feb 1916 Mena Camp, Cairo. Moved from SIDI BISHR 0930. Left SIDI GABER 1215 arrived CAIRO 1845. Tea at Station. Marched to MENA CAMP 11 1/2 miles.
2 Feb 1916 Reorganizing Camp.Usual parades & routine.
3 Feb 1916 Usual parades & routine
4 Feb 1916 Parades etc. as usual.
5 Feb 1916 Inspection of Camp by Brigadier. Also kit & equipment inspected.
6 Feb 1916 Church parade at 1030 by Rev HOOD, Bde Chaplain
7 Feb 1916 Brigade Route March. CAIRO ROAD. Batt on Bde, Division & Camp duties
8 Feb 1916 Inspection by Gen. Sir J.MAXWELL at 0815 with excellent results, the Division being congratulated on its excellent appearance after hardships undergone on PENINSULA
9 Feb 1916 Parades & Routine as usual
10 Feb 1916 Inspection by Brigadier at 0900. Bde Route March 0930 CAIRO ROAD.
11 Feb 1916 Parades etc as usual. Bde field day. The batt being on Division and Camp duties were very weak on parade. Some officers from LOVAT SCOUTS accompanied the Batt for training.
12 Feb 1916 Draft of 1 Officer Capt Miskin [Christopher Harold MISKIN, MC] & 420 O.Rs arrived from ENGLAND. Men not very fit, suffering from old wounds etc. Mostly 1st & 2nd Battn Bedford Regmnt. men. Draft of 1 Officer & 18 men returned from Depot. [Comment; Officer arrived was 2/Lt E.S. CATON]

5 Apr 1916 - CAIRO. Left Camp at 1400 & marched 11 1/2 miles to CAIRO ABU EL ELA Station at 17.30. Men given tea and entrained. Train left at 1950.
6 Apr 1916 - SHALUFA. Arrived SHALUFA at 0330. Men given tea. Baggage transported across SUEZ CANAL. Batt marched to BDE Camp 1/2 mile E. of CANAL. Tents pitched. Baggage manhandled to Camp from CANAL.
7 Apr 1916 Batt Route March. usual parades including bathing in CANAL. Line of outposts in half semicircle about 1000 yards from Bde Camp taken up 6 Posts Mounted at 1800 relieved at 0700.
8 Apr 1916 Parades as usual
9 Apr 1916 Church Parade at 0900
10 Apr 1916 Digging on Lunettes Nos 1 & 2. Column of 4 Officers & 100 O.R's (Capt James [Christopher Russell JAMES, MC] in command) proceeded out E as escort to 3 squadrons of Yeomanry on reconnaissance towards BIR EL GIDDI & BIR EL TAWAL (Ref MAP EGYPT sheet C.19 1/100,000) [Comment; attached under Appendices]
11 Apr 1916 Usual Parades. draft of 2 officers 80 O.R's under Major Clutton [John CLUTTON] arrived. [Comment; Officer arriving - Lt. Geoffrey Robert TAYLOR of the 4th Battalion]
12 Apr 1916 Digging on Lunettes 1 & 2 C Subsection CANAL ZONE.
13 Apr 1916 Route March & Ordinary Parades
14 Apr 1916 Orders received for move to KUBRI 6 miles S. of SHALUFA. Baggage sent forward by lighter
15 Apr 1916 Marched at 0630 arrived KUBRI 0900. Tents pitched & baggage brought up from wharf. Capt C.R.JAMES [Christopher Russell JAMES, MC] & party returned from Column work.
16 Apr 1916 Church Parade at 0900. 200 men warned to stand by for firing column work under Capt Miskin [Christopher Harold MISKIN, MC] (A Coy & balance from B)
17 Apr 1916 Orders for column received from Gen. TAYLOR for column. Lt Col Brighten [Edgar William BRIGHTEN, CMG, DSO, TD] to command mixed force, 300 1/5 Bedf, 25 Camel Corps, 75 Yeomanry, R.A.M.C & Engineers sections and Camel Transport Convoy. Remainder of Batt. ordinary parades

9 Jun 1916 Orders received for the Battalion to move out as a mobile column on the 11th
10 Jun 1916 Trench work. Arrangements for column made by Companies & men detailed, necessitating considerable alterations in the garrisons at GURKHA & BALUCHISTAN POSTS.
11 Jun 1916 - Geneffe Railhead Column paraded at 0430 and marched to SHALUFA arriving at about 0720. Breakfasts & quarters for the day arranged. Bathing parades held. Moved off again at 1700 and arrived at GENEFFE 1800. Proceeded straight on to GENEFFE RAILHEAD arriving at 1748. Camel Transport arrived at 2030. Bivouacs arranged. Orders received to move E at 0500
12 Jun 1916 Marched off at 0500 bearing 80 degrees true. Bivoacked at 0830 at Pt 555. Received orders to return to RAILHEAD (GENEFFE). For training purposes a rear guard action was practised. Arrived at GENEFFE RAILHEAD, last company in at 2130. Casualties on column nil. Received orders to be ready to move at 0615 in the morning.
13 Jun 1916 - Shalufa Paraded at 0615. Inspected by Brigadier Gen MUDGE Commdg Column 1 hours close order drill by order of O.C. Column. Returned to Bivouacs for the day. Orders received to return independently to station. Moved off at 1630 & arrived SHALUFA 1915. Night spent in huts [Comment; 2/Lt H.H. SPERLING arrived]
14 Jun 1916 - EL KUBRI. Moved off at 0430 & arrived at KUBRI 0715

1 Sep 1916 - EL SHATT. Training. 1700 Details arrived from KUBRI under Lt.L.P.New [Leslie Perry NEW]. Pte. Ashpole [Private 3933 Joseph ASHPOLE] escaped from Hospital and Swam across the Canal. Evidently quite insane.
2 Sep 1916 0500 Pte Ashpole caught and sent to Hospital 0530 Battalion Drill. 0630 Battalion Route March of 10 miles 1700 Battalion gave concert in recreation Hut. Great success. 1830 Parties proceeded to ZEITOUN
3 Sep 1916 0900 Inspection of lines & buildings by Brig. General WATSON. 1030 Church Parade. Major G.M.de L.Dayrell [Gerald Marmaduke de Longport DAYRELL] arrived to take over duties as 2nd in command of Batt. Orders received that BIR MABEUIK moveable column would move out on 7th & return 8th September.
4 Sep 1916 Usual training. Notified that ALWAR Infantry would take over all Northern Battalion duties at retreat 6th inst.
5 Sep 1916 0800 G.O.C. 162 Bde inspected Batt. at training. Lectured to all officers and N.C.O's at 1000 on Fire Control. 1700 Further orders received re BIR MABEUIK. Lt. Col. E.W.Brighten [Edgar William BRIGHTEN, CMG, DSO, TD] to command the Column 2200 London's Patrol reported 6 horsemen in front. All posts warned. Nothing seen by our patrols.
6 Sep 1916 Usual Training. CO lectured to all N.C.O's. 1800 Band played outside club at PORT TEWFIK. Lieut. Col. E.W. Brighten [Edgar William BRIGHTEN, CMG, DSO, TD] proceeded on leave to ALEXANDRIA. Major G.M.de L. Dayrell [Gerald Marmaduke de Longport DAYRELL] took over command of battalion.
7 Sep 1916 - BIR MABEUIK. Usual Parades. 1700 Battalion fell in ready to move off for BIR MABEUIK. 1715 Advance guard moved. 1725 Main body moved. 1735 Rear Guard moved. Capt C.H. MISKIN [Christopher Harold MISKIN, MC] took over command of details. 2000 Concentrated at Pt.309 2330 Arrived bivouac. Going good & men marched well but were very tired. Settled down and waited for camels for blankets. Camels arrived 0300 8th. Stand to 0415
8 Sep 1916 - EL SHATT RAILHEAD. Major G.M.de L. Dayrell [Gerald Marmaduke de Longport DAYRELL] and 2nd Lt.N.R. Taitt [Noel Rothwell TAITT, MC] proceeded with Brig.General WATSON to entrance of RAWA PASS for reconnaissance. 1615 Column moved. 'A' Coy. 1/5th BEDFORDS - Advance Guard. Artillery. 'B', 'D' & 'C' Coys. 1/5th BEDFORDS. Rear Guard of one Platoon furnished from 'B' Coy 2000 Arrived at EL SHATT RAILHEAD 2130 Battalion concentrated there by that time. Only eight casualties although going very bad at times. These were brought in on an ambulance.

17 Sep 1916 0945 Church Parade. 1800 Party of 2 officers & 100 O.R.'s 1/5th BEDF.R. & one officer & 50 O.R.'s 1/5th NORTHANTS.R. attached to 1/5th BEDF.R. proceeded to SIDI BISHR REST CAMP.
18 Sep 1916 3 officers & 155 O.R's 1/4th NORTHANTS R. from KUBRI joined the Batt. arriving in two detachments, 2 officers & 120 OR's at 0850 one officer & 35 OR's at 1050. 6 ORs 1/5th BEDF.R. who fell out on the column reported with first party of NORTHANTS. 1730 3 O.R's reported from column. 1900 Received wire from A/Adj. Column that Pte. Fox of 'B' Coy. killed and Pte.Meeks 'D' Coy wounded. Parades as usual [Comment; Private 5814 William FOX of Hertford and Private 2983 Percy MEEKS were the Battalions first combat casualties since Gallipoli - Percy recovered and survived the war]
